Krakow, a beautiful Polish City! - 07/31/2005

After our sober visit of Auschwitz, our team visited the beautiful city of Krakow.  Apparenly, Krakow is one of the few Polish cities that had not been destoyed by the war.  The city is beautiful, with ancient churches and cathedrals seemingly on every street corner.  Krakow is the birth city of Pope John-Paul II.  We saw John Paul II memoriabilia in most of the stores.
